Default High Temp Urea Grease?

I am about to change out my clutch but in the helms it calls for a high temp urea grease for the throw-out bearing, which I cannot find anywhere except on A&H (for 12$+8 for shipping) . The closest thing that I could find is some bearing grease which is good to up to 500 degrees. Do you think that is sufficient? Anyone else use another grease for the TO bearing or know where to find an adaquate substitute for what the Helms calls for?
